skills/test-health/SKILL.md
Holistic test coverage measurement. Use when: assessing test health, measuring coverage trends, quantitative + qualitative test audit. Not for: running tests (use verify), reviewing test sufficiency only (use codex-test-review), generating tests (use codex-test-gen). Output: multi-dimensional dashboard with coverage metrics + test inventory + trend.

| Mode | Trigger | Content | Duration |
|------|---------|---------|----------|
| quick (default) | /test-health | Test inventory + consume artifacts + trend delta | <15s |
| full | /test-health --full | Phase A→B→C→D (feature coverage + instrumentation + qualitative + aggregation) | 2-5min |

references/trend-schema.md)| Priority | Method | Trigger | Output |
|----------|--------|---------|--------|
| 1 | Consume existing artifact | Default (quick + full) | source_type: instrumented_artifact |
| 2 | Run project coverage command | --collect flag only (opt-in) | source_type: collected_now |
| 3 | Heuristic proxy (test/source file ratio) | No artifact and no --collect | source_type: heuristic |
Prohibited: Never auto-install coverage tools (c8, nyc, istanbul, pytest-cov, tarpaulin, jacoco).

| Rule | Description |
|------|-------------|
| No composite score in v1 | Multi-dimensional dashboard, no single blended number |
| Changed-file focus | Prioritize git diff files for coverage check |
| Source transparency | Every metric tagged: instrumented / heuristic / missing |
| Qualitative coupling | Full mode always runs Phase C even if quantitative metrics are green |
| Tool change detection | tool_id change resets trend line |
| Stale detection | Artifact older than HEAD marked stale |
| Policy | Behavior | |--------|----------| | Advisory (default) | Output dashboard + verdicts, do not block | | Strict (v2, opt-in) | Changed files with zero tests block |
v1 implements advisory mode only.

| Ecosystem | Detection | Coverage Artifact | Test Count Parser |
|-----------|-----------|-------------------|-------------------|
| Node.js | package.json | coverage/ dir (LCOV/Istanbul/Jest) | node:test / jest / vitest |
| Python | pyproject.toml / setup.py | coverage.xml | pytest |
| Go | go.mod | cover.out | go test -json |
| Rust | Cargo.toml | tarpaulin-report.json / cobertura.xml | cargo test |
| Java | build.gradle / pom.xml | build/reports/jacoco/ | gradle/maven |
| Unknown | — | Scan for lcov.info / cobertura.xml | File count fallback |
Graceful degradation: no artifact + no coverage command = heuristic proxy + source_type: heuristic.
